The Purpose of Minecraft Realms

Minecraft Realms, developed by Mojang Studios, serves as an official subscription-based service designed to offer players a secure and exclusive multiplayer experience. The primary purpose of Realms is to provide an alternative to public servers, creating a controlled environment for players to share their virtual adventures only with invited friends or family members. By doing so, Realms ensure a more personalized and intimate gaming space where players can enjoy a sense of community with their chosen group.

Customization Options

Minecraft Realms offer a plethora of customization options, allowing players to tailor their worlds according to their preferences and playstyles. Realm owners have control over various settings, including the game mode (survival, creative, adventure), the difficulty level, and the inclusion of custom resource packs or mods. Moreover, players can choose from a variety of world templates, each offering a distinct landscape and ambiance. This level of customization empowers players to curate their unique gaming environment, making their realm a reflection of their individuality and creativity.
